4,400-year-old copper weapons discovered in UP; discovery sheds new light on Ganga Valley's ancient culture

Vijaya Kumar, a city-based archaeologist and former DGP, has discovered copper weapons in Shahjahanpur linked to the Ochre Coloured Pottery culture. Carbon dating reveals these artefacts date back to 2400 BC, pointing to an ancient Chalcolithic culture in the Ganga Valley. The findings are published in the Indian Journal of Archaeology.
